CI note: the Brindlewick ingest service is spamming ~2M log lines per run, which blows past the runner's disk quota and kills the job. I've enabled 1% sampling on INFO and kept WARN/ERROR at full volume — see the config diff in stage three. Failures are still reproducible with sampling on, promise. You can verify against the trace token below.

build token for kafof-hahif: htk6_462aaf

**Vendor note: Inkmill markdown pipeline**

Rendering for Parchway docs is outsourced to Inkmill under an annual contract, renewing each March. They handle sanitization and PDF export; we own the upload queue. SLA: 4-hour response on rendering failures. Escalate only after two failed retries. Their support desk is reachable at the address below.

billing contact of hahaf-baguf = zorael.tammir.jorius@sivrelhq.internal

Handover for the Pellgrove slimming work: the multi-stage Dockerfile is done and merged. Runtime image is distroless now, so there's no shell — use the debug sidecar if you need to poke around. Remaining task is trimming locale data from the builder cache. Benchmarks live in the perf folder. The current image is built with these settings.

service settings:
[casax]
port = 6379
team = rusir
host = casax.zemvarhq.corp
region = outer-4
access_code = ac_9808ce
timeout_ms = 1500

Subject: Marchetta Retail Pilot — Status and Next Steps

Executive team,

The eight-store pilot with Marchetta Goods is live across their Halloran district. Early sell-through is tracking 11% above forecast, with restock cadence holding steady. Two fixture issues were resolved on-site. Sales leads should prepare expansion scenarios for twenty and fifty stores, including margin sensitivity at each tier.

Decision checkpoint is in six weeks.

The confidential note on our retail strategy follows below.

internal memo for kawip-hadug: Headcount on the Wenwyn team goes from 7 to 140 by the end of January. Gross margin on Wenwyn came in at 20 percent against a plan of 15 percent.